Bond University College Foundation Program

Bond University Colleges Foundation Program is designed for international students only who have completed the equivalent of Australian Year 11 and meet the English language requirements to prepare them for undergraduate study at Bond University. If you are an Australian citizen, New Zealand citizen or holder of an Australian permanent visa student, please see Bonds Diploma Preparation Program. The two-semester full-time study program focusses on the core academic and English language skills, as well as the key independent learning skills required for university-level studies with alternate pathways to help you transition into your chosen undergraduate program.

Structure

TOTAL CREDIT POINTS : 80

Subjects

  • BCFN01-003: Foundation Mathematics 1 (10CP)
  • BCFN01-010: Foundation English 1 (10CP)
  • BCFN01-012: Foundation English 2 (10CP)
  • BCFN01-021: Foundation Mathematics 2 (10CP)
  • BCFN01-022: Modern History (10CP)
  • BCPP01-001: Academic Communication Skills (10CP)
  • BCPP01-002: Applied Academic Communication Skills (10CP)
  • BCPP01-003: Digital Literacy (10CP)
